How Our Document Drying Service Works
Our process for Document Drying Services is designed to get your documents back to their original condition as quickly and safely as possible. We start by containing the affected area to prevent further damage, then use specialized equipment to extract the water and dry your documents. Our technicians are IICRC-certified and have the training and expertise to handle even the toughest jobs.
Step 1: Containment
Our team sets up a containment system to prevent further damage and protect your belongings from contamination. This includes sealing off the affected area and setting up air scrubbers to remove any musty odors.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Next, we use specialized equipment to extract the water from your documents and the surrounding area. This includes wet vacuums and pumps that are designed to remove as much water as possible in a single pass.
Step 3: Drying
Once the water has been extracted, we use specialized drying equipment to dry your documents and the surrounding area. This includes desiccants, air movers, and dehumidifiers that work together to remove any remaining moisture.
Step 4: Monitoring
Throughout the drying process, our technicians will continuously monitor the moisture levels in your documents and the surrounding area. This ensures that your belongings are drying properly and that there are no hidden pockets of moisture that could cause further damage.
Step 5: Final Inspection
Once the drying process is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your documents are dry and free of any damage. We’ll also provide you with a detailed report on the work we’ve done and any recommendations for future maintenance.

Document Drying Services Cost in Cadwell, GA
The cost of Document Drying Services can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Cadwell, GA. Here are some estimates for the services we offer: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Document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ions |
| Containment and Extraction |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of containment system used |
| Monitoring and Inspection | $100 – $500 | Frequency and duration of monitoring and inspection |
| Dehumidification and Drying | $300 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of drying equipment used |
| Final Cleaning and Disinfection |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ning solution used |
Keep in mind that these estimates are based on the services we offer and may vary depending on the specifics of your job.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ate and customized plan after assessing the damage on-site.
